SUMMARY:Sierra Hull
DESCRIPTION:After a Grand Ole Opry debut at age 11\, a Presidential Scholarship to Berklee College of Music\, and producing creds on her latest album by banjo-master Bela Fleck\,the now 25 year-old vocalist and instrumentalist continues to chart new territory for Americana\, Bluegrass\, and Roots music\n“She plays the mandolin with a degree of refined elegance and freedom that few have achieved\,” – Bela Fleck\,.\nAngel Snow Opening Act 7:30- 8pm\nTICKETS: VIP* $25/ GA -$15/ Bucks Students- FREE (ID Required)

SUMMARY:Lord\, Write My Name
DESCRIPTION:Nationally-recognized baritone vocalist\, Keith Spencer\, and award-winning composer and arranger\, Peter Hilliard\, team up once again after their critically-acclaimed collaboration\, Brothers on Broadway\, to present Lord\, Write My Name – A Gospel and African American Experience in Spirituals\n.\nLord\, Write My Name is an inspirational musical tapestry of African American Spirituals interspersed with narratives\, poetry\, and letters penned by enslaved\, emancipated\, and iconic Black people throughout history. This educational presentation explores themes of mourning expressed through Spirituals countered by the powerful and redemptive story of the Gospel message. \nIn this masterful collection of song and word\, Spencer\, accompanied by Hilliard on piano\, performs well-known Spirituals such as “Go Down\, Moses\,” “Walk Together Children\,” “Joshua Fit the Battle of Jericho\,” “Steal Away\,” and several others brilliantly reimagined and arranged by Hilliard. \nThis beautiful and uplifting concert shares themes of social justice\, identity\, and the hope that connects us all.
